The Invisible Engine of Tomorrow
At its core, what is bitcoin? It’s not just a digital coin; it’s a brilliant, decentralized network, a public ledger maintained by millions, secured by cryptography. Think of it like the internet itself, but for money and value. When the internet first emerged, people saw it as a place to send emails or browse static web pages. They missed the underlying protocol that would eventually connect humanity, ignite global commerce, and redefine information flow. Bitcoin, and its siblings like ethereum and xrp, are doing the same for finance. This uses a distributed ledger system—in simpler terms, it means no single entity controls the entire record, making it incredibly resilient, transparent, and, critically, permissionless. Anyone, anywhere, can participate.
